Join us for a hands-on insect collection adventure in the Cleveland National Forest to help safeguard California’s incredible biodiversity!

We’ll provide the gear, training, and lunch—you bring your curiosity and sense of adventure. No experience needed!

California is one of the world’s biodiversity hotspots, and your efforts will help scientists monitor ecosystem changes and protect vulnerable species. All samples go to the Natural History Museum of Los Angeles County for ID.

This field day is part of the California Biodiversity Project, led by Adventure Scientists in partnership with Stillwater Sciences and the California Institute for Biodiversity.
